Purpose of the Town Center Plan?

City leaders understand that a thriving city must continue its successes. A thriving city is in a perpetual state of study, planning, design, implement to meet the needs and opportunities of a growing, livable community. Hanahan has numerous development and redevelopment successes, from downtown streetscaping, a new City Hall, and renovated City Gym to the Hanahan Amphitheater, Tanner Plantation, and Bowen Village, to name a few.  To this end, leaders embarked on a master planning process with the purpose to:

Envision and implement a Town Center Plan for downtown Hanahan that creates new opportunities for bringing people together and for establishing businesses and investments that will sustain Hanahan as a "Wonderful Place to Live, Work, and Play."

Goals of the Master Plan

City leaders established the following goals to guide the creation of the master plan, ensuring recommendations keenly focused on revitalizing downtown Hanahan. 

  • Create a visionary and attainable roadmap for developing a vibrant, unique, and sustainable Town Center that captures and leverages the Charleston metropolitan area growth. 
  • Create a capture and leverage plan that maximizes the Town Center real estate, the future Rivers Avenue/Remount Road Bus Rapid Transit (BRT) stop, the popularity of the Amphitheater, the new soon-to-be named park, existing local businesses, the Goose Creek Reservoir and the Cooper River. 
  • Amplify the master plan with opportunities for third places that invite residents and visitors to linger, walk, shop, and contribute to the local economy. 
  • Set the stage for a new Town Center that is ready for new investments and ripe for planting flags of new restaurants, retail, and unique local businesses. 
  • Imbue an authentic sense of place that distinguishes Hanahan from the surrounding cities and towns.
  • Reinforce Hanahan 2040: Pathway to the Future by creating an implementation framework for revitalizing the Town Center. 
  • Incorporate development and planning best practices from similar cities. 
  • Identify opportunities that create a dense, walkable, mixed-use district that becomes a thriving part of Hanahan's story.
  • Engage and listen to the community to shape a master plan that reflects the City's vision.
